titleOfInvention Custom hip design and insertability analysis
abstract Computer implemented methods, systems, and computer products employing program code or algorithms for use in customized patient specific hip implants or femoral stems or sleeves having an outer surface that corresponds more closely to the inner surface of the cortical bone of a patient's femur compared to conventional hip implant or femoral stems or sleeves based on population-based design.
